The Wildcats started off hot, overwhelming the Seawolves with a three-touchdown lead to begin the game. However, Stony Brook was able to settle in.
Although the Seawolves had trailed going into halftime, they exploded in the second half and once they rallied to take the lead—they hardly looked back, going on to win 29-27.
Penalties, miscues, and the lack of offensive production allowed Stony Brook to forge a second half comeback, and it relished in every opportunity.
Stony Brook outgained Villanova, 267-79, in the second half.
